Twins prospect Kaelen Culpepper has been named to the All-Stars Futures Game roster for the second consecutive season as he waits for his MLB debut.

The 2024 first-round pick, currently playing for Triple-A St. Paul Saints, is one of the Twins’ top prospects. A trip to the majors could come this year. In the meantime, he’ll be in the showcase for the game’s top prospects on July 12 during the all-star week’s festivities in Philadelphia.

“It’s my second straight year doing it, and it’s a huge honor,” Culpepper said. “So, I’m pretty excited about that. I want to play in the Futures Game, get some digs. I’m just being patient, ready for my name to be called.”

Culpepper has been eyed for promotion, but a hip strain sidelined him for two weeks in June.

“I think when you’re sitting on the bench for two weeks, trying to rehab and recover, you learn a lot about yourself,” the shortstop said on Thursday.

“I just need to be more active in the training room, take it more seriously, never doubt anything,” he continued. “I never take anything for granted.”

That lesson was hammered home on Tuesday, when he was hit in the hand by a pitch. Now, he’s day-to-day. When he returns is up to his trainers, but he reported no lingering pain two days later.

Though when the ball hit, he admitted, “95 straight to the hand never feels good.”

Culpepper would know — he’s been hit by six pitches this season.

Nearing the halfway point of his first Triple-A season, Culpepper is posting a .272/.376/.492 slash line heading into Saturday’s play, with an .868 OPS — nearly all career highs since being drafted in 2024. He was tied for the eighth-most runs in the International League (54), tied for the 16th-most homers (14) and tied for 28th in stolen bases (15).

Culpepper grew up in Tennessee, where he admits baseball wasn’t the most competitive. He went to Georgia to get on the map, and while he had an opportunity to sign professionally after graduating high school, he wasn’t highly recruited. He’d commit to Kansas State University, where he says he proved himself as a freshman.

In his first year, he hit .283/.356/.428 with five homers and 27 runs. He slashed .328/.419/.574 with a .993 OPS, 11 homers and 50 runs in his junior year, before being picked 21st overall by the Twins in 2024.
